Agartala, Sept 2 (TIWN) As per the instructions of the Election Commission of India (ECI), the summary revision of the photo electoral rolls (PER) of 60 assembly constituencies of Tripura began Monday, Chief Electoral Officer (CEO) Ashutosh Jindal said.
“With the draft publication of PER, the four-month long process of summary revision of the voters’ list has commenced. After completion of all formalities, the final publication of the rolls would be made January 6 next year with January 1 (2014) as the qualifying date of age for new inclusion,” Jindal told reporters.
As per the draft PER, total number of voters in Tripura is 23, 48, 951 including 11,52,274 is female and 11,96,677 male.
“The ECI has made mandatory of the declaration of all voters to inform the authority whether his or her name included in the PER of other places or not,” said Jindal, who was an international observer in national assembly polls in Cambodia recently.
